Output 6391759f84b955618954aef8848a281a2abfeb4d1913e8e99c751f91b0aa4084:3

value
311036
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e0c99354e7f4ac5392d2fdcf68b78cc2d707b3525640b96ddd96f7be15a1985
address
bc1p3cxfjd2w0a9v2wfd9lw0dzmceskhq7e4y4jqh9kam9hhhc26rxzshw56az
transaction
6391759f84b955618954aef8848a281a2abfeb4d1913e8e99c751f91b0aa4084